The Couch Critic
Couch Critic
Movies
TV Shows
Trending
Top Reviewed
What to Watch
Movies
TV Shows
Trending
Top Reviewed
What to Watch
Guo Zhenjia | The Couch Critic
Place of Birth
Inner Mongolia, China
Known For
Acting
Guo Zhenjia
Movies
TV Shows
Dragon's Awakening
Movie
Cast
October 23, 2019